### 2.9.0 — Default changes (for eng sync)

Spreadsheet exports in Tallygrove previously buffered entire workbooks in memory, which caused the OOM spikes we discussed two weeks ago. Exports now stream rows in fixed-size chunks and spill to temp storage past a threshold. Peak memory on the export workers dropped roughly 70% in staging. Chunk size and spill limits are tunable per deployment. The new defaults are listed here.

settings of tagef-bawif:
DRUIX_HOST=druix.zemvarlabs.internal
DRUIX_PORT=8000

## Runbook: Retrying Failed Exports (Quillbox)

If a customer's export job dies, don't panic — most failures are transient storage hiccups. Pull up the job in the Quillbox admin panel, hit Retry once, and wait five minutes. Two failures in a row means escalate to the pipeline team. When escalating, include the trace token shown below.

build token for kagaf-hahof: htk14_9d3d4d26d7d8de

Handover Note — For the Sales Leads

Passing the baton from me to Director Enfield here. The big item: we're shifting Pellgrove's Skylark tier to annual billing next quarter. Monthly plans stay for legacy accounts through renewal. Expect some pushback from the mid-market folks — discounting guidance is in the shared deck. The reasoning behind the timing is outlined below.

board note of tawip-hahip: Only 7 of the 80 pilot accounts renewed Ralath, so a churn review is set for April 1.

**Mgmt Meeting Minutes — Retiring the Brightline Range**

Quick recap for sales leads at Fenholt Supplies: we agreed to retire the Brightline fixture range by year-end. Remaining stock moves to clearance pricing next month, and accounts on standing orders get migrated to the Lumetta range. Trade-in incentives were approved in principle. The confidential note on next steps sits just below.

board note of bajof-bajeg: The pricing group signed off on a budget of $13.4 million for Project Sildor. The renewal with Lamixek Holdings closes at $48.9 million a year, 49 percent above the last contract.